Why it was recalled
A window that opens unexpectedly as a result of a crash or contact with the window may allow the passenger to be ejected from the bus, increasing their risk of injury.
What was recalled
Motor Coach Industries (MCI) is recalling certain model year 2015-2016 J4500 vehicles manufactured April 14, 2015, to February 22, 2016. On the affected vehicles, the non-egress single pane passenger windows may have improperly installed mounting hardware, allowing the windows to open unexpectedly at the bottom.
What to do
MCI will notify owners, and dealers will tighten and secure the window mounting hardware, free of charge. The recall began on July 22, 2016. Owners may contact MCI customer service at 1-800-241-2947. MCI's number for this recall is SB 433B.. Follow the official notice for full instructions.
